Output d6d8a18495ab326ae0fd0b947332f2e16ce043faf571497213af188379547de3:1

value
21074344
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e020549ca637bbb47c1d1ce8018d35e44c9b3bb34d17e472e96c0c9adcad7810
address
bc1puqs9f89xx7amglqarn5qrrf4u3xfkwanf5t7guhfdsxf4h9d0qgqchesk9
transaction
d6d8a18495ab326ae0fd0b947332f2e16ce043faf571497213af188379547de3
spent
true